    Supernatural is an American television series that follows the thrilling adventures of two brothers, Sam and Dean Winchester. The show combines elements of horror, fantasy, and drama as the brothers travel across the United States to battle supernatural creatures and otherworldly forces. With an engaging mix of intense action, gripping storytelling, and compelling characters, Supernatural has captivated audiences since its debut in 2005. The series explores themes of family, loyalty, and destiny, as the Winchesters confront their own personal demons while saving humanity from the supernatural threats that plague the world.

    Batwoman is a superhero television series based on the DC Comics character of the same name. The show follows Kate Kane, a highly skilled fighter who takes up the mantle of Batwoman to protect Gotham City from crime and corruption. With a combination of martial arts expertise and cutting-edge technology, Batwoman fights against a variety of super villains and unravels mysteries plaguing the city. The show explores themes of identity, societal expectations, and justice, while also delving into the personal struggles and relationships of its characters.

    Saved! is a 2004 American independent satirical black comedy film. The plot follows a devout Christian high school girl who becomes pregnant after having sex with her boyfriend, in an attempt to "cure" him of his homosexuality. The film explores themes of religious satire and contemporary teen issues.
